LAYOUT

Beginning forward is the Vee-berth with port and starboard berths for two and with triangle filler, hanging lockers and access to the port side guest head. A separate storage locker is to starboard. Next aft is the main cabin/salon with a U-shapped dinette to port and settee to starboard that can convert to an upper and lower berth for two. The galley is further aft and to port with the navigation station to starboard and deck access on center. The portside companionway aft provides engine room access, and the master stateroom is aft with extra-long double berth for two, private head with shower, hanging and drawer storage.

 

GALLEY

Custom 6 cu/ft refrigerator and separate 4 cu/ft freezer compartments each with Crosby dual holding plates and Seafrost compressor (new 2023), Force 10 3-burner propane stove (new 2023) with two 2.5 gallon aluminum tanks, GE microwave oven (new 2020), custom teak liquor bar between galley and salon, charcoal filtered drinking water faucet and  separate sea water faucet at deep double stainless steel sink, Formica counter tops, 5 gallon electric water heater (new 2020).

 

DECOR

The décor is teak and holly flooring with a varnish finish, teak cabinetry, vinyl headliner, maroon-colored Sunbrella cushions, tastefully decorated with nautical features.

 

MECHANICAL

Single Perkins 4.154 62hp inboard diesel with 86 hours since major overhaul, fresh water cooled, 900 Racor fuel filter, Borg Warner marine transmission, Northern Lights 8.5KW diesel generator with 2950 hours, 500 Racor fuel filter, mechanical wheel steering with autopilot driven hydraulic steering, 16,000BTU reverse cycle Marine Aire A/C system split to both staterooms (new 2023), 12,000BTU reverse cycle A/C for salon, galley and navigation station,  ECHOTec 12 volt 288 gallon per day water maker (new 2020), Crown Raritan 12v toilet in MSR head (new 2025), Maxi-Prop propeller (new 2021), Xantrex 2000 watt inverter (new 2020), Newmar 12 volt 80 amp battery charger, EPsolar solar controller with remote panel (new 2020), five bank battery system- all West Marine gel cel batteries that are diode protected, Niehoff 60 amp brushless alternator (new 2023), engine room overboard discharge hoses that have JIC screw on fittings (no hose clamps), two 30 amp 110 volt shore power cords, shaft line cutting spurs, electric oil change system.

DECK

Fiberglass non-skid decks, stainless rail stanchions with cable life lines, custom stainless steel manual davits for tender and solar panels mounted on top (new 2020), custom stainless steel swim re-boarding ladder on transom, custom stainless steel portable boarding ladder on port side, Ideal 12 volt anchor windlass (factory reconditioned 2020) with foot pedal control and remote cockpit control, one 45lb plow anchor with 150’ of chain (new 2020) and 150’ of rode, spare 40lb Danforth anchor with 150’ of rode, spare 40lb Danforth anchor, Achilles inflatable tender with 15hp 2-stroke Yamaha outboard (new 2023) and 2hp Honda pony engine, black Sunbrella dodger top with stainless steel frames and three sided isinglass enclosure and additional black Sunbrella cockpit bimini top with stainless frames, Viking 8-man life raft with ACR PLB EPIRB packed inside.

ELECTRONICS

Sony HTA 3000 Dolby soundbar with Sony 200 watt subwoofer in salon (new 2026), 12-volt Sony AM/FM/CD player in salon with Bose speakers in salon and MSR (new 2023), LG 24” LCD TV salon with Bose sound bar (new 2020), Samsung 24” LCD TV MSR with Bose sound bar (new 2020), Raymarine Axiom Pro 12 Doppler radar with 4kw radar dome (new 2023), Garmin 541 GPS map, Magellan 1000 hand held GPS, Raymarine SmartPilot with rotary drive and new hydraulic pump (2023), Raymarine i50/i60 digital depth, speed and wind direction indicator (new 2023), ICOM ICM 605 VHF, Raytheon 45 VHF (new 2023), ICOM M802 single side band radio (factory reconditioned 2023), Sirius satellite weather receiver (new 2023), Danforth 5” compass, Raymarine 700 AIS transceiver (new 2023), Qunatum 2 cell phone booster antenna (new 2023), ACR Cat 1 EPIRB.

SAILS & RIGGING

Harken roller furling for jib, dual tracks on main mast for storm mainsail, running inner forestay and running back stay for storm inner jib sail, 140% roller furling heavy jib sail with reefing to 110%, main sail and mizzen with seven additional sails: 95% jib, storm tri sail, storm jib,  Martin mizzen, two Barient #22 cockpit winches, two Barient #28 cockpit winches, one Barient 22SS main mast halyard winch, two Barient 21SS main mast halyard winches, two Barient #18 mizzen mast halyard winches.

The Biggest Pros and Cons

The 1978 Gulfstar Ketch is a classic cruising sailboat known for its sturdy construction and traditional design. Here are some of the pros and cons to consider:

Pros

Solid Build Quality: Gulfstar yachts from this era are renowned for their robust fiberglass construction, offering durability and longevity.

Ketch Rig Advantage: The ketch rig provides versatile sail plans, making it easier to balance the sail area and handle in varying wind conditions, especially for short-handed crews.

Spacious Interior: The 1978 Gulfstar Ketch typically features a roomy interior layout with comfortable accommodations, suitable for extended cruising.

Stable and Comfortable Ride: The design offers good stability and a comfortable motion at sea, which is appreciated during long passages.

Ample Storage: Plenty of storage space below deck for provisions and gear, beneficial for longer voyages.

Cons

Older Systems: Being a vessel from 1978, many mechanical and electrical systems may require upgrading or maintenance.

Heavier Displacement: The sturdy build comes with a heavier displacement, which can result in slower speeds compared to more modern, lighter designs.

Sail Handling Complexity: The ketch rig, while versatile, involves managing more sails and rigging, which can be more labor-intensive, especially for inexperienced sailors.

Potential for Outdated Interior: The interior styling and materials may feel dated and could require refurbishment to meet modern aesthetic preferences.

Limited Performance: Designed primarily for cruising comfort rather than racing, so it may not satisfy those seeking high-performance sailing.
